Description

circular, the lid set with a circular enamel plaque painted with an allegory of love in the form of a young woman kneeling by a putto statuette with turtle doves nearby, in a split-pearl frame, on a translucent plum-coloured enamel ground over sunray engine-turning, embellished with interlaced paillon flower and leaf garlands in two-coloured gold, the outer chased leaf and bead borders highlighted in green and red translucent enamel, maker's mark,


2 ⅜ in., 6 cm. diameter
